Compiled by Afro-Indigenous staff at NDN Collective, the list captures a glimpse of the experiences of our Black Relatives, prompting us to continue listening, learning and leaning into kinship efforts that uplift our joint struggles toward liberation and sovereignty. In honor of Black History Month, NDN Collective curated the following list of books by Black and Afro-Indigenous authors that speaks to Black history, Black liberation and Black futurism.
